About the role


Grade 9 Content Procurement Senior Manager

Grade 9 Resource Discovery Senior Manager


An exciting and unique opportunity has arisen to join the new senior team in Collections Management at The Bodleian Libraries, Oxford University. We are transforming how we work to better deliver the needs of library users and reflect the changing environment of the sector. This has opened up two new senior manager positions to drive the new direction and strengthen team alignment.

If you are passionate about making a positive change, are motivated by strategic and innovative problem solving and have experience in successfully transforming a team, we'd love to hear from you.

A background in Higher Education is preferable, however if you are an experienced manager with transferable skills and experience who would enable Collections Management to achieve its goal as a centre of excellence, please do not hesitate to apply.

This is a permanent, full-time position, working 37.5 hours per week. Both roles support some home working, up to 2 days per week on average.
